Transaction a6330877c9f2c0a44b1c95fe476d9197de670aeced3d7bda583a4e66c2bb0c43

1 Input
2 Outputs
  • a6330877c9f2c0a44b1c95fe476d9197de670aeced3d7bda583a4e66c2bb0c43:0
  • value  252000000
    address  3CxgKmRKDfeMtFQimTC72AavbyEHbzxz6P
  • a6330877c9f2c0a44b1c95fe476d9197de670aeced3d7bda583a4e66c2bb0c43:1
  • value  151213466
    address  18mkPnJdSVefnBavFeD3wH9SaqtjELudqo